Analysis
The most recent figure for sweet potatoes — gross production value in Mexico is 16,635 1000 USD, measured in 2024.
The figure is down 13.3% on the previous year and up 59.9% over ten years.
Over the whole period, sweet potatoes — gross production value in Mexico peaked at 39,748 1000 USD in 1967 and was at its lowest, 6,935 1000 USD, in 1980.
That places Mexico 45th out of 82 countries with data for 2024, putting it in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 64 years of available data.

About this data
The domain provides detailed data on the value of agricultural production that is calculated by the agricultural production data and the price data at farm gate. Thus, the value of production measures the agricultural production in monetary terms at the farm gate level.
